PER CURIAM.

The petition for belated appeal is granted. A copy of this opinion shall be filed with the trial court and be treated as the notice of appeal from the March 1, 2021 judgments and sentences rendered in Case Nos. 2020-301597-CFDB, 2020-301598-CFDB, 2020-301669-CFDB, 2020-303086-CFDB, and 2020-303184-CFDB, in the Circuit Court in and for Volusia County, Florida. See Fla. R. App. P. 9.141(c)(6)(D).

PETITION GRANTED.

COHEN, EISNAUGLE and NARDELLA, JJ., concur.
